GST (Goods and Services Tax) is India's unified indirect tax that replaced multiple state and central taxes in July 2017. It follows a dual structure: CGST (Central GST) goes to the central government and SGST (State GST) goes to the state government for intra-state transactions. For inter-state transactions, IGST (Integrated GST) is levied and later distributed between centre and state. India has 4 main GST rates: 5%, 12%, 18%, and 28%, plus a 0% category for essential goods.
How do I add GST to a price?+
To add GST: Total Price = Base Price × (1 + GST Rate/100). For example, if base price is ₹10,000 and GST rate is 18%, total = ₹10,000 × 1.18 = ₹11,800. GST amount = ₹1,800. For intra-state: CGST = ₹900 (9%) + SGST = ₹900 (9%). Use our calculator above to compute any amount instantly.
How do I remove GST from an MRP price?+
To remove GST from an MRP: Base Price = MRP / (1 + GST Rate/100). For ₹11,800 MRP at 18% GST: Base = ₹11,800 / 1.18 = ₹10,000. GST amount = ₹11,800 - ₹10,000 = ₹1,800. Select "Remove GST" mode in our calculator and enter the MRP to get the base price instantly.
What is the difference between CGST, SGST and IGST?+
CGST (Central GST) and SGST (State GST) are both charged on intra-state (within same state) transactions, each at half the total GST rate. IGST (Integrated GST) is charged on inter-state transactions at the full GST rate and is later split between centre and state. For example, an 18% GST intra-state transaction has 9% CGST + 9% SGST. The same transaction inter-state has 18% IGST.
What GST rate applies to services in India?+
Most services in India are taxed at 18% GST. Key exceptions: AC restaurants charge 5% (no ITC), non-AC restaurants 5%, hotels below ₹7,500/night 12%, hotels ₹7,500+ per night 18%. Financial services (banking, insurance) generally 18%. Health and education services are typically exempt. IT/software services: 18%. Consulting and professional services: 18%.
